Landmarks – Brodnax, Virginia
Inscription. A Fort Called Christ-Anna: You are standing at the site of Fort Christanna, a colonial fort laid out in 1714 by Virginias Governor Alexander Spotswood. The fort was built on a tract of land set aside in 1714 for a trading ... More on HMDB

Museums – Danville, Virginia
The Langhorne House is the birthplace of Nancy Langhorne, Viscountess Astor, the first woman seated in the British House of Commons. Her sister Irene, also born in Danville, married the artist Charles Dana Gibson who immortalized ... More on Virginia.org
